"GC301 - The Multi" takes the basic "A Longer Walk", and extends
the walk, and ups the difficulty by requiring you to find two
caches in order to get the "Smiley". The first cache is at the
posted coordinates, and is a smaller container. In a wooded
environment, this makes the first cache the harder of the two.
You've done well so far, so you shouldn't have any problems. Once
again, the walk is the thing. Take you time and enjoy your
surroundings.
Parking and trail head locations are left as an exercise for the
student. depending on where you start, expect a 2.5 to 3 mile round
trip. Please pay attention to "Posted" signs. Some of the trails,
while on WMA Property, abuts private property.

Maps are available at the DEM Website. You should
let someone know where you are headed, and bring a cell phone. A
caching buddy is also a good idea. Please plan accordingly, and
wear appropriate clothing and shoes, and bring enough water and
food for the walk. An emergency card such a
this one is also a good idea.
Fluorescent Orange Requirements for users
of State Management Areas can be found in the Park
& Management Area Rules & Regulations (Section 16.7).
It is the user's responsibility to know the rules before hiking in
the Wildlife Management Areas.
